NTFS (New Technology File System) et FAT32 (32-bit File Allocation Table) sont deux formats de système de fichiers couramment utilisés. Il existe quelques différences entre eux en termes de gestion des données et de performances, les différences entre eux sont détaillées ci-dessous.
Tout d'abord, NTFS est un système de fichiers avancé développé par Microsoft, tandis que FAT32 est le premier système de fichiers de Microsoft. NTFS est largement utilisé dans les systèmes d'exploitation après Windows NT, notamment Windows XP, Windows 7, Windows 8 et Windows 10. En revanche, FAT32 est un système de fichiers utilisé par les versions antérieures de Windows et peut être trouvé dans les versions antérieures de Windows telles que Windows 95, Windows 98 et Windows ME.
En termes de gestion des données, NTFS offre de meilleures capacités de sécurité et de gestion de fichiers que FAT32. NTFS prend en charge les paramètres d'autorisation pour les fichiers et les dossiers et peut définir différentes autorisations d'accès pour chaque utilisateur ou groupe d'utilisateurs afin de mieux contrôler et protéger la sécurité des fichiers. De plus, NTFS prend en charge des tailles de fichiers plus grandes et des noms de fichiers plus longs. Les noms de fichiers dans le système de fichiers NTFS peuvent contenir jusqu'à 255 caractères, tandis que FAT32 ne peut prendre en charge que les noms de fichiers plus courts.
Une autre différence importante est que NTFS utilise l'espace disque plus efficacement. NTFS utilise des algorithmes d'indexation et de distribution de fichiers plus complexes, réduisant ainsi le problème de fragmentation du disque. FAT32 utilise une méthode de stockage de données relativement simple et directe, ce qui peut facilement conduire à une fragmentation du disque et réduire les performances du système.
De plus, NTFS fournit également des fonctionnalités avancées telles que la récupération de données et le cryptage de fichiers. La fonction de journalisation de NTFS peut enregistrer l'historique des opérations du système de fichiers et il peut être récupéré via le journal même après une panne du système ou une panne de courant inattendue. FAT32 n'a pas une telle fonction de journalisation. De plus, NTFS peut également définir des attributs de chiffrement pour les fichiers et les dossiers afin de fournir une sécurité des données plus avancée.
En ce qui concerne les performances, NTFS offre de meilleures performances lors de la gestion de fichiers volumineux et de disques de grande capacité, tandis que FAT32 est plus performant lors de la gestion de petits fichiers et de disques de petite capacité. En effet, NTFS gère les fichiers en utilisant des tables d'allocation et des index de fichiers plus complexes, ce qui le rend plus efficace lors d'opérations de données à grande échelle. Mais pour les disques de petite capacité, FAT32 utilise une structure de données plus simple, les performances seront donc légèrement meilleures.
Pour résumer, NTFS et FAT32 sont deux formats de système de fichiers courants qui présentent des différences significatives en termes de gestion des données et de performances. Par rapport à FAT32, NTFS offre des capacités de gestion de fichiers plus avancées, une meilleure sécurité et des performances plus élevées, mais FAT32 peut être légèrement plus performant lorsqu'il s'agit de petits fichiers et de disques de petite capacité. Par conséquent, lors du choix d'un format de système de fichiers, vous devez décider quel système de fichiers utiliser en fonction de scénarios et de besoins d'application spécifiques.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!